Job Title: R&D Engineer Project Manager II

Location: Plymouth, MN 55442

Duration: 07+ Months



Duties:
Executes to defined business results expected from a project. Is responsible and accountable for achieving those results; where results are expressed in terms of compliance with Design Control and/or Change Control policies; quality; time; scope and cost.
A project is a set of interrelated tasks that culminates in clearly defined business results.
For new product development projects; the business results will typically include the launch of one or more products.
Differences across the levels of Project Manager are dependent upon increasing project complexity and increasing level of expected independence. Each higher level incorporates the expectations from the lower levels.
Manage moderately complex project or several smaller low complexity projects with the assistance from their manager.
Evaluates Risk/Reward Trade-offs: Provides risk assessments (both safety and project related) and communicates critical issues impacting product quality to management (Q01 and Q04.01.004)).
Establish and maintain risk analysis as part of overall responsibility to control / reduce risk (QO4.01.001)
Recognizes strategy; quantifies and evaluates risks; recommends actions and develops contingencies to cope with various scenarios.
Able to analyze risk / reward trade-offs and make recommendations of appropriate path forward.
Translates Project Goals: Translates project ADD goals into the day-to-day activities necessary to accomplish them
